TY - JOUR PY - 2004// TI - Low-tension electrical injury as a cause of atrial fibrillation: a case report JO - Texas heart institute journal A1 - Varol, Ercan A1 - Ozaydin, Mehmet A1 - Altinbaş, Ahmet A1 - Dogan, Abdullah SP - 186 EP - 187 VL - 31 IS - 2 N2 - Electrical injury can cause a variety of cardiac arrhythmias. Atrial fibrillation as a result of such injury is fairly rare, however, and is rarer still in cases of low-tension electrical injury. We present the case of a patient who developed acute atrial fibrillation in association with low-voltage electrical injury, which resolved after the intravenous administration of digoxin.
